Comprehending Prams and Strollers
Before diving into their differences, it's important to comprehend what makes up a pram and a stroller.
Prams:
A pram, brief for perambulator, is typically developed for infants approximately around 6 months old. It features a flat, padded sleeping location and is mostly meant for transporting really children. Prams are developed for comfort and security, as newborns require to lie flat to support their spinal column and organs.
Strollers:
Strollers, or pushchairs, are developed for a little older kids who can sit up unaided. They can be found in numerous styles and setups, from light-weight umbrella strollers to heavier-duty models suitable for rough terrains. Strollers are more versatile and easier to steer in crowded areas, making them a popular choice for active families.

When to Make the Transition
The shift from a pram to a stroller usually happens when the kid reaches around six to seven months of age or when they can stay up unassisted. Nevertheless, several elements can affect this transition, consisting of:
Child's Development: If the kid shows signs of wishing to explore their environments, it might be time to change to a stroller.Household Lifestyle: Active households might require a stroller earlier to accommodate getaways and travel.Convenience: Observe the kid's convenience level. If they appear cramped in a pram or are becoming more active, it's time to think about a stroller.Picking the Right Stroller
